Output 102cc9986c8e516b73f28cb6700cfaa9e722950f3f08b34eb7febb30d8a38157:7

value
332589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2095513ff3d80fb9e1b997001a29021654c5a0d OP_EQUAL
address
3PkndPWE4ss8ns7b4MoEus2PronapdfdYa
transaction
102cc9986c8e516b73f28cb6700cfaa9e722950f3f08b34eb7febb30d8a38157
spent
true